5-Bromo-6-chloropyrazin-2-amine
5-Bromo-6-chloropyrazin-2-amine (Compound 110) is an organic compound used as an intermediate in the synthesis of various bioactive molecules. 5-Bromo-6-chloropyrazin-2-amine is promising for research of bacterial infections, such as tuberculosis[1].
